Liking cljdoc? Tell your friends :D

goose.brokers.redis.console.pages.cron


delete-jobclj

(delete-job {:keys [prefix-route]
             {{:keys [redis-conn]} :broker} :console-opts
             params :params})
source

delete-jobsclj

(delete-jobs {{{:keys [redis-conn]} :broker} :console-opts
              :keys [prefix-route]
              params :params})
source

get-jobclj

(get-job {:keys [prefix-route]
          {:keys [app-name] {:keys [redis-conn]} :broker} :console-opts
          params :params})
source

get-jobsclj

(get-jobs {:keys [prefix-route]
           {:keys [app-name] {:keys [redis-conn]} :broker} :console-opts
           params :params})
source

job-tableclj

(job-table {:keys [cron-name cron-schedule timezone]
            {:keys [execute-fn-sym queue args ready-queue]
             {:keys [max-retries retry-delay-sec-fn-sym retry-queue
                     error-handler-fn-sym death-handler-fn-sym skip-dead-queue]}
               :retry-opts}
              :job-description})
source

jobs-tableclj

(jobs-table {:keys [base-path jobs]})
source

purge-queueclj

(purge-queue {{{:keys [redis-conn]} :broker} :console-opts
              :keys [prefix-route]})
source

validate-get-jobsclj

(validate-get-jobs {:keys [filter-type filter-value]})
source

cljdoc is a website building & hosting documentation for Clojure/Script libraries

× close